NTS Engineering Co.,Ltd tests and evaluates the wastewater from the High-Tech Park (HTP) – FPT Building (F1–F2) in Thu Duc by conducting sampling, analysis, and comparison with current standards. This process determines the level of pollution, assesses treatment efficiency, and allows for system adjustments to minimize negative impacts on the surrounding environment.

All wastewater from the HTP building is collected and directed to the wastewater treatment system, which is designed with a treatment capacity of 180 m³/day.night. Through testing and evaluation, NTS Engineering Co.,Ltd found that the influent had a low flow rate, white foam appeared in the equalization tank, and several wastewater parameters had not reached ideal levels.

Faced with the above issues, NTS quickly resolved each issue, ensuring the system operates more efficiently, stably, and appropriately.

Challenge

Some of the challenges that NTS found after evaluating the wastewater at the project are as follows:

  • The system has an actual wastewater flow that is too low compared to the tank system's capacity. The reason was the reduction in building operations during the COVID-19 period (2020–2021), which led to a much lower influent volume than the originally calculated design capacity
  • The equalization tank has white foam. This may be due to the influent containing too many types of cleaning chemicals

The above problems affect the system's treatment quality. Therefore, NTS needs to take prompt and appropriate corrective measures.

Solution

From the wastewater test results, NTS has proposed appropriate solutions for each problem, specifically:

  • Adjust the discharge valve of the air conditioner pump to help the system operate smoothly with appropriate capacity
  • Other solutions are listed in detail in the Analysis Results Report sent to the Investor

Results

The system has resumed stable operation, and the treated wastewater meets the required standards. The effluent ensures environmental safety, contributing to green - clean- sustainable operations.
